Survey results shows high customer confidence in approved code garages

Posted 24/02/14

A survey of 57,000 people has revealed that 95% of people using a Trading Standards Institute (TSI) approved Motor Codes garage would recommend it to friends and families, with a 97% overall satisfaction rating.

An approved code is a voluntary way for businesses to ensure they provide the best service possible to consumers. 

In a combination of online reviews, manufacturer and dealer group surveys and a targeted survey of over 3,000 car buyers, Motor Codes found a 10% increase in customer satisfaction, from 84% in 2009 to 94%. This year's survey saw 14,000 more surveys than in 2013.

TSI chief executive Leon Livermore said: "This survey shows that consumers appreciate the high quality service that is provided by businesses bearing the TSI approved codes logo. It is integral for businesses to get it right every time and with these results showing that this is happening, code members can only benefit.

"Consumer confidence contributes positively to local and national economies, and eradicating rogue traders from operating within an industry can only ever be a good thing. I congratulate Motor Codes and their scheme members on these outstanding results."

Motor Codes managing director, Chris Mason, had a resounding message for car owners: “For satisfaction levels to remain so high across a customer-base of this size tells people that they can choose a garage with confidence, wherever they see the Motor Codes tick.”

Trading Standards Institute (TSI)

TSI is a training and membership organisation that has represented the interests of the Trading Standards profession since 1881 nationally and internationally. We aim to raise the profile of the profession while working towards fairer, better informed and safer consumer and business communities. TSI’s members are engaged in delivering frontline trading standards services in local authorities and in businesses. www.tradingstandards.gov.uk 

Motor Codes:

Motor Codes operates Trading Standards Institute-approved codes of practice that raise and maintain standards in the service and repair and new car sectors.

The New Car Code covers over 99% of all new cars sold in the UK and regulates the advertising, sale, warranty, replacement parts availability and complaint handling processes for new cars.

The Service and Repair Code helps motorists to identify responsible garages, offers a structured complaints procedure and promotes good customer service. There are currently over 7,800 approved Motor Codes businesses across all parts of the UK, main dealers and independent garages.  Millions of motorists benefit from the code’s protection and standards, in addition to the free advice line and dispute resolution service.

The code commits subscribing garages to:

  • honest and fair service
  • open and transparent pricing
  • completing work as agreed
  • invoices that match quoted prices
  • competent and conscientious staff
  • a straightforward and swift complaints procedure

It offers motorists:

  • a free motoring advice line (0800 692 0825)
  • an online garage finder tool, complete with real-time ratings, to locate the nearest reputable garage
  • free conciliation and low cost, legally binding arbitration
